New York, recorded 1758–87) dated 1759. Powder Horn. dated 1749. … dc wendy and marvinWebJan 22, 2016 · The architecture of the horn reflects the F&I period. The “lobes” with the two holes in them at the base end were common in the period, but much less seen by the time of the American Revolution. The engraving around the base end on the horn is taken from a John Bush horn from the “Lake George School” done in the F&I War. d.c. westWebMark Thomas continues the tour of his Virginia workshop by sharing a tutorial on how to scrape a Scottish Highland cow horn to turn it into a rifle powder ho... geisinger hospice careWebSep 26, 2024 · The powderhorn is scrimshaw, and is elaborately carved.
